Output dc6de24e7b0b3e49028a405afb6c54dfd297fef8e1ec67cda95ab2cece607882:6

value
43920636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 635e261dd4d8adbadb3605eb5ff39cb108a0cd70 OP_EQUAL
address
MGxZv1278ZAYwXy6kjrFMVo6EMdPSRuXQD
transaction
dc6de24e7b0b3e49028a405afb6c54dfd297fef8e1ec67cda95ab2cece607882
spent
true